''The Midshipman Or The Corvette And Brigantine: A Tale Of Land And Sea'' is a novel written by Joseph Holt Ingraham and published in 1845. The story follows the adventures of a young midshipman named Harry Bowling, who is sent on a mission to capture a notorious pirate. Along the way, he encounters various challenges and dangers, including shipwrecks, battles, and treacherous villains. The novel is set in the early 19th century and provides a detailed and vivid portrayal of life at sea during that time. It also explores themes of loyalty, courage, and honor, as Harry struggles to fulfill his duty as a naval officer while also staying true to his own moral compass.
